news 2026/5/1 9:16:48

3大核心方案:Linux游戏启动器从零部署完全指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
3大核心方案:Linux游戏启动器从零部署完全指南

3大核心方案:Linux游戏启动器从零部署完全指南

【免费下载链接】HeroicGamesLauncherA Native GOG, Amazon and Epic Games Launcher for Linux, Windows and Mac.项目地址: https://gitcode.com/GitHub_Trending/he/HeroicGamesLauncher

还在为Epic游戏在Linux系统运行不畅而困扰吗?开源游戏启动器Heroic Games Launcher让这一切变得简单。本指南通过"问题场景-解决方案-验证效果"三段式结构,帮你5分钟内完成从安装到启动游戏的全流程,同时解决Wine依赖、中文显示等常见痛点。读完本文你将获得:3种安装方案对比、Proton配置技巧、常见问题速查手册。

启动黑屏?3步快速排查与部署方案

问题场景:首次安装启动器后出现黑屏或界面无响应,无法正常进入游戏库界面。

解决方案:采用Flatpak一键安装方案,自动处理所有依赖关系。添加Flathub仓库后执行安装命令:

fl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o flatpak install flathub com.heroicgameslauncher.hgl

验证效果:安装成功后,启动器界面正常显示,游戏库加载完整:

项目配置文件electron-builder.yml定义了完整的桌面集成方案,包括图标路径、MIME类型注册等系统级配置,确保启动器与Linux桌面环境完美兼容。

GOG平台游戏无法启动?依赖管理深度解析

问题场景:GOG平台游戏安装后启动失败,缺少必要的运行时环境支持。

解决方案:通过源码编译方式获取最新特性支持,确保所有依赖正确安装。首先克隆仓库:

git clone https://gitcode.com/GitHub_Trending/he/HeroicGamesLauncher cd HeroicGamesLauncher

然后执行构建命令:

pnpm install pnpm download-helper-binaries pnpm dist:linux

验证效果:构建成功后生成AppImage等可执行文件,所有运行时依赖完整:

package.json中的scripts字段详细定义了构建流程,包括开发环境启动、测试运行和不同平台的打包输出。

Wine配置复杂?简化部署与验证流程

问题场景:Wine和Proton配置过程繁琐,游戏兼容性测试耗时较长。

解决方案:利用Heroic内置的Wine管理器自动下载和配置运行时环境。通过src/frontend/screens/WineManager界面选择Lutris-GE或Proton-GE版本,实现最佳游戏兼容性。

验证效果:运行时环境配置完成后,Epic游戏和GOG平台游戏均可正常启动运行,性能表现稳定。

中文显示异常?本地化配置优化方案

问题场景:游戏界面或启动器中出现中文乱码,字体显示不完整。

解决方案:安装完整的中文字体包,并通过public/locales/zh_Hans目录下的翻译文件确保界面完全中文化。

验证效果:中文字体安装后,所有界面元素显示正常,游戏内文字无乱码问题。

云存档同步失败?跨设备数据管理

问题场景:游戏进度无法在不同设备间同步,手动备份操作繁琐。

解决方案:启用src/backend/save_sync.ts模块的自动同步功能,配置Epic或GOG账号的云存档服务。

验证效果:云存档功能正常后,游戏进度自动同步,跨设备游戏体验无缝衔接。

部署效果验证与进阶技巧

效果验证:成功部署后,Heroic Games Launcher将提供完整的游戏库管理、多平台账号集成、云存档同步等核心功能。启动器界面美观实用,游戏运行流畅稳定。

进阶技巧

  • 自定义主题:通过src/frontend/themes.scss文件调整界面风格
  • 手柄支持:配置src/frontend/helpers/gamepad_layouts目录下的布局文件
  • 性能监控:利用src/backend/systeminfo模块监控系统资源使用情况

三种部署方案对比:

  • Flatpak方案:适合新手用户,自动更新机制完善
  • 源码编译:适合开发者,可获取最新特性和功能
  • 系统包管理:适合生产环境,系统集成度高

通过本文提供的完整部署指南,Linux游戏玩家可以轻松实现Epic游戏和GOG平台游戏的完美运行,享受流畅的游戏体验。

【免费下载链接】HeroicGamesLauncherA Native GOG, Amazon and Epic Games Launcher for Linux, Windows and Mac.项目地址: https://gitcode.com/GitHub_Trending/he/HeroicGamesLauncher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 8:48:12

AudioShare音频共享工具:让Windows声音在安卓设备上自由流动

AudioShare音频共享工具:让Windows声音在安卓设备上自由流动 【免费下载链接】AudioShare 将Windows的音频在其他Android设备上实时播放。Share windows audio 项目地址: https://gitcode.com/gh_mirrors/audi/AudioShare 你是否曾想过,能否将电脑…

作者头像 李华
网站建设 2026/4/30 3:55:52

TotalSegmentator终极指南:医学影像分割从入门到精通

TotalSegmentator终极指南:医学影像分割从入门到精通 【免费下载链接】TotalSegmentator Tool for robust segmentation of >100 important anatomical structures in CT images 项目地址: https://gitcode.com/gh_mirrors/to/TotalSegmentator 在当今医学…

作者头像 李华
网站建设 2026/4/30 5:21:02

MediaPipe入门指南:5步快速掌握跨平台AI开发

MediaPipe入门指南:5步快速掌握跨平台AI开发 【免费下载链接】mediapipe Cross-platform, customizable ML solutions for live and streaming media. 项目地址: https://gitcode.com/gh_mirrors/me/mediapipe 想要轻松构建支持多平台的AI应用?Me…

作者头像 李华
网站建设 2026/4/30 17:39:59

TIDAL音乐下载神器:从零开始的完整使用指南

TIDAL音乐下载神器:从零开始的完整使用指南 【免费下载链接】tidal-dl-ng TIDAL Media Downloader Next Generation! Up to HiRes / TIDAL MAX 24-bit, 192 kHz. 项目地址: https://gitcode.com/gh_mirrors/ti/tidal-dl-ng 在数字音乐时代,TIDAL以…

作者头像 李华
网站建设 2026/5/1 8:54:36

联想M920x黑苹果实战指南:5步打造完美macOS体验

联想M920x黑苹果实战指南:5步打造完美macOS体验 【免费下载链接】M920x-Hackintosh-EFI Hackintosh Opencore EFIs for M920x 项目地址: https://gitcode.com/gh_mirrors/m9/M920x-Hackintosh-EFI 想要在普通PC上体验macOS的流畅操作吗?联想M920x…

作者头像 李华
网站建设 2026/5/1 5:49:13

Qwen3-VL飞行模拟训练:仪表盘读数识别与操作纠错

Qwen3-VL飞行模拟训练:仪表盘读数识别与操作纠错 在现代航空领域,一次微小的操作失误可能引发连锁反应,最终导致严重事故。尽管飞行模拟器早已成为飞行员训练的核心工具,但长期以来,其智能化水平却始终受限于传统技术架…

作者头像 李华